In the afternoon we headed into West Yellowstone and there is a small, bustling town there. They had a coffee shop/book shop that had wifi, which worked much better than the wifi at our campsite and we were able to get the pictures uploaded and the kids posts from Days 1 and 2 onto the blog. A huge success and much less frustrating. I think we will do the same thing tomorrow with the rest of the posts that need to get on there.
We visited the Visitor’s Centre and got an idea of some of the things we would like to do while we are in Yellowstone and bought our park pass for the time that we are here. Natasha had made us a packed lunch so we decided to do a shorter hike today that was close to the town and we headed out to do that. On the way we saw and elk sleeping in the tall grass on a small island in the river. We stopped to get a picture of it and check it out. She/he didn’t like Kizmet being so close, even though the river separated us and she started to duck her head in and out. As soon as I moved away with Kizmet she settled down again. Then we headed off to hike Harlequin Lake. It was just a short hike, one mile round trip, but it was lovely to be out and walking in the sun and not organizing the RV or worrying about our blog posts. It was a pretty little lake with thousands of lily pads that were blooming beautiful yellow flowers. We let Kizzy off because no one was around and she had a great time dipping into the water and running around. There was a trail that followed the lake for a bit so we took that to the end and then turned around and headed back. All together I think we were only gone an hour, but it was so nice.
